Copy soong variables to dist
Per aosp/2183398, out/soong/soong.variables provide some useful information for debugging purpose. This change enables copying out/soong/soong.variables to out/dist/soong_ui/soong/soong.variables in dist mode, similar to build.ninja.gz in the same directory. Test confirmed that the content of the out/soong/soong.variables is equal to that of out/dist/soong_ui/soong/soong.variables. Test: m dist $target && diff out/soong/soong.variables out/dist/soong_ui/soong/soong.variables Change-Id: I1bfa53a8e116c49fda2cc9a7252f4da0c59ce5b5
This commit is contained in:
@@ -1326,6 +1326,10 @@ func (c *configImpl) KatiPackageNinjaFile() string {
|
||||
return filepath.Join(c.OutDir(), "build"+c.KatiSuffix()+katiPackageSuffix+".ninja")
|
||||
}
|
||||
|
||||
func (c *configImpl) SoongVarsFile() string {
|
||||
return filepath.Join(c.SoongOutDir(), "soong.variables")
|
||||
}
|
||||
|
||||
func (c *configImpl) SoongNinjaFile() string {
|
||||
return filepath.Join(c.SoongOutDir(), "build.ninja")
|
||||
}
|
||||
|
Reference in New Issue
Block a user